Golang Data Engineer

1 week ago


Maryland Heights, Missouri, United States neteffects Full time
About the Role

We are seeking a highly skilled Golang Data Engineer to join our team at NetEffects. As a key member of our data engineering team, you will be responsible for designing, building, and maintaining large-scale data pipelines and systems.

Key Responsibilities
  • Design and implement cloud-based data pipelines and systems using Golang and other technologies.
  • Work closely with cross-functional teams to ensure data quality, security, and compliance.
  • Develop and maintain automation scripts using Golang, Python, and Bash.
  • Collaborate with data scientists and engineers to design and implement data-driven solutions.
  • Monitor and optimize data processing systems for performance and scalability.
Requirements
  • 7+ years of experience in data engineering, with a focus on cloud-based systems.
  • Strong understanding of Golang, Python, and Bash programming languages.
  • Experience with containerization using Docker and Kubernetes.
  • Knowledge of data processing technologies such as Apache Kafka and Google BigQuery.
  • Ability to communicate technical concepts effectively to both technical and non-technical stakeholders.
Desirable Skills
  • Experience with machine learning and feature engineering.
  • Knowledge of geospatial tools and environmental data.
  • Experience with data preprocessing and feature engineering.

  • Data Modeler

    1 month ago


    Maryland Heights, Missouri, United States Match Point Solutions Full time

    Job Title: Data ModelerMatchPoint Solutions is a fast-growing, young, energetic global IT-Engineering services company with clients across the US and internationally. We provide technology solutions to various clients, leveraging industry-specific best practices and expertise.We are seeking a skilled Data Modeler to join our team. The ideal candidate will...

  • Principal Engineer

    4 weeks ago


    Maryland Heights, Missouri, United States Spectrum Full time

    Job Title: Principal EngineerWe are seeking a highly skilled Principal Engineer to join our team at Spectrum. As a key member of our engineering team, you will be responsible for driving process innovation and overseeing the implementation of process improvements for our Billing system.Key Responsibilities:Support business process improvement, functional...


  • Maryland Heights, Missouri, United States Spectrum Full time

    About the RoleSpectrum's Product and Technology team is seeking a highly skilled Security Engineer I to join our Information Security, Engineering team. As a key member of our team, you will be responsible for engineering activities that monitor, detect, and alert on potential security threats and vulnerabilities to our telecommunications data and database...

  • Principal Engineer

    1 week ago


    Maryland Heights, Missouri, United States Spectrum Full time

    Job Title: Principal EngineerAs a Principal Engineer at Spectrum, you will drive process innovation and oversee the implementation of process improvements for our Billing system. You will support business process improvement, functional process improvement, and organizational development.Key Responsibilities:Perform requirement capturing, data modeling,...


  • Maryland Heights, Missouri, United States Actalent Full time

    Job SummaryWe are seeking a highly skilled Senior Quality Assurance Engineer to join our team at Actalent. As a key member of our quality control team, you will be responsible for providing technical expertise in analytical testing, instrumentation, and laboratory data evaluation.Key Responsibilities:Provide technical counsel on scientific content of methods...


  • Maryland Heights, Missouri, United States Spectrum Full time

    About the RoleSpectrum's Product and Technology team is seeking a highly skilled Security Engineer I to join our Information Security, Engineering team. As a key member of our team, you will be responsible for engineering activities that monitor, detect, and alert on potential security threats and vulnerabilities to our telecommunications data and database...


  • Maryland Heights, Missouri, United States Spectrum Full time

    About the RoleSpectrum's Product and Technology team is seeking a highly skilled Security Engineer I to join our Information Security, Engineering team. As a key member of our team, you will be responsible for engineering activities that monitor, detect, and alert on potential security threats and vulnerabilities to the company's telecommunications data and...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Job Summary:As a Senior Software Engineer at Spectrum, you will design, develop, test, and implement software systems, including OLTP database systems. You will perform maintenance on existing software products, implement complex business logic, and work in an environment with a short development cycle. You will design and develop Oracle PL/SQL code, perform...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Job Summary:As a Principal Engineer I at Spectrum, you will drive process innovation and oversee the implementation of process improvements for Charter Communications' Billing system. Your expertise will support business process improvement, functional process improvement, and organizational development.Key Responsibilities: Perform requirement capturing,...


  • Maryland Heights, Missouri, United States Charter Communications Full time

    Spectrum's Product and Technology team is driving innovation in the nation's fastest mobile service, most reliable internet service, most viewed live TV app, and the most advanced WiFi, serving nearly 100 million users and 500 million devices.We are transforming the next era of connectivity and entertainment experiences. Our team is diverse and offers...


  • Maryland Heights, Missouri, United States Spectrum Full time

    About the InternshipSpectrum is seeking a motivated rising senior to participate in a 10-week internship program in software engineering. This program is designed to provide hands-on experience in software development and give you essential business insights.ResponsibilitiesCollaborate with experienced team members to contribute to software development...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Drive Innovation in Billing SystemsAs a Principal Engineer I at Spectrum, you will play a key role in driving process innovation and overseeing the implementation of process improvements for our Billing system. Your expertise will be instrumental in supporting business process improvement, functional process improvement, and organizational development.Key...


  • Maryland Heights, Missouri, United States Wave Full time

    Job Summary:As a Principal Engineer I at Wave, you will drive process innovation and oversee the implementation of process improvements for our Billing system. You will support business process improvement, functional process improvement, and organizational development.Key Responsibilities:Perform requirement capturing, data modeling, design, development,...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Spectrum is a leading provider of mobile and internet services, and we're looking for a talented software engineer to join our team as an intern. As a software engineer intern, you'll have the opportunity to work on real-world projects, collaborate with experienced team members, and gain hands-on experience with Java and other...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Billing Systems Engineer RoleDrive process innovation and oversee the implementation of process improvements for Charter Communications' Billing system. Support business process improvement, functional process improvement, and organizational development. Perform requirement capturing, data modeling, design, development, and implementation of Mobile Billing...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Job SummaryWe are seeking a highly skilled Senior Software Engineer to lead our software development team in designing, developing, testing, and implementing software systems, including OLTP database systems. The ideal candidate will have a strong background in Oracle PL/SQL, Unix, and complex SQL queries, as well as experience with Industry ETL, scheduling...


  • Maryland Heights, Missouri, United States Charter Communications Full time

    Are you an experienced problem-solver with a passion for delivering innovative solutions using the latest technological tools? Do you have a strong analytical mindset and excellent collaboration skills? If so, you may be a great fit for the Billing Operations & Technology team at Charter Communications.We're looking for a skilled Associate DevOps Engineer to...


  • Maryland Heights, Missouri, United States Spectrum Full time

    Spectrum Internship ProgramWe are seeking a motivated and talented individual to join our team as a Software Engineer Intern. As a member of our team, you will have the opportunity to gain hands-on experience in software development, collaborate with experienced team members, and contribute to the development of Java-based applications.Key...


  • Maryland Heights, Missouri, United States Charter Communications Full time

    About the RoleSpectrum's Product and Technology team is a dynamic and innovative group of professionals who are transforming the next era of connectivity and entertainment experiences. As a Software Engineer III on the Agent Tools team, you will play a critical role in creating software solutions that use prevailing technologies and improve the customers'...


  • Maryland Heights, Missouri, United States Deutsche Precision, LLC Full time

    Job DescriptionDeutsche Precision, LLC is seeking a Quality Technician to support the production department through in-process inspections and audits, data documentation, and application of SPC methods to analyze data and recommend process changes.The ideal candidate will possess an Associate's degree in mechanical or quality engineering, or equivalent...